Prove that the line of centres of two intersecting circles subtends equal angles at the two points of intersection.

Theorem
Advertisements

Solution


Let two circles having their centres as O and O’ intersect each other at point A and B respectively. Let us join OO’.


In ΔAOO’ and BOO’,

OA = OB   ...(Radius of circle 1)

O’A = O’B   ...(Radius of circle 2)

OO’ = OO’   ...(Common)

ΔAOO’ ≅ ΔBOO’   ...(By SSS congruence rule)

∠OAO’ = ∠OBO’   ...(By CPCT)

Therefore, line of centres of two intersecting circles subtends equal angles at the two points of intersection.
